Phytochemical screening, antioxidant and anti-edematous activities of aqueous extract of Sarcocephalus latilolius (sm.) Bruce ripe fruits in rat,

Extract at 10 mg/mL yielded 92.95±11.44 mg EAG/g total polyphenols, 0.082±0.005 mg ERu/g total flavonoids and 0.14 ± 0.003 mg EAT/g condensed tannins. Aqueous extract of Sarcocephalus latifolius ripe fruits showed DPPH radical inhibition with an IC50 greater than 25 μg/mL. DPPH inhibition by gallic acid was 92.91% at 25 μg/mL. IC50 of ascorbic acid and aqueous extract of Sarcocephalus latifolius on Fe3+reducing antioxidant power (FRAP) were 18.9 μg/mL and 111.6 μg/mL, respectively.
